We recently completed this mobile dental vehicle for the Ronald McDonald House Charities (RMHC) of Ozarks, Missouri. The unit is built on a Freightliner MT-55 forward control chassis and features an all aluminum body construction and a bright and colorful wrap. To stabilize the truck when deployed, a vehicle leveling system has been installed. The dental unit also has a wheelchair lift integrated into the body for accessibility. Sliding windows have also been added, two are egress. Entry into the vehicle is by curbside entry door.
Inside, the vehicle has two patient rooms. The front of the vehicle has a workstation with custom aluminum cabinetry. Magnetic closure pocket doors are utilized throughout for privacy. The front patient room has a dental exam chair, custom aluminum cabinets and a sink. We also installed customer-supplied equipment. The center of the vehicle features a check in desk with spider base task chair and a fixed bench seat to be used as a waiting area. The rear patient room has another dental exam chair, corner sink and additional storage cabinetry. Counter tops are solid surface throughout. Each patient room has a 19" LED display monitor which can display video from the installed Blu-Ray disc player.
Additional features include a galley with microwave and refrigerator. A pressurized water supply system is also installed. HVAC duties are handled by three ducted low profile A/C units, a wall mounted electric heater and 3 direct discharge furnaces. A powerful 25kW liquid-cooled diesel generator has also been installed. A full vehicle surge suppression system protects all of the installed electronics. A power retracting shore power cord reel is installed inside one of the exterior compartments. A perimeter camera system has been installed as well.
